Apple Calendar

Apple Calendar is the default, high-performance choice for anyone embedded in the Apple ecosystem. It is deeply integrated into macOS, iOS, and iPadOS, providing a smooth, battery-efficient experience that respects user privacy. LaunchDarkly (Open Source SDKs)

LaunchDarkly is a leading feature flag management platform offering robust targeting and experimentation capabilities. It supports SDKs for numerous programming languages and frameworks, allowing for seamless integration into existing projects.
